Πώς μπορώ να περιορίσω τους χρήστες στο Linux;

Περιορίστε την πρόσβαση του χρήστη στο σύστημα Linux χρησιμοποιώντας περιορισμένο κέλυφος. Αρχικά, δημιουργήστε έναν συμβολικό σύνδεσμο που ονομάζεται rbash από το Bash όπως φαίνεται παρακάτω. Οι ακόλουθες εντολές θα πρέπει να εκτελούνται ως χρήστης root. Στη συνέχεια, δημιουργήστε έναν χρήστη που ονομάζεται "ostechnix" με το rbash ως προεπιλεγμένο κέλυφος σύνδεσης.

Ποια είναι η εντολή περιορισμού των χρηστών στο Linux;

Ωστόσο, εάν θέλετε μόνο να επιτρέψετε στον χρήστη να εκτελέσει πολλές εντολές, εδώ είναι μια καλύτερη λύση:

  1. Αλλάξτε το κέλυφος χρήστη σε περιορισμένο bash chsh -s /bin/rbash
  2. Δημιουργήστε έναν κατάλογο bin κάτω από τον αρχικό κατάλογο χρήστη sudo mkdir /home/ /bin sudo chmod 755 /home/ /αποθήκη.

10 σεντ. 2018 г.

Πώς διαχειρίζομαι τους χρήστες στο Linux;

Αυτές οι λειτουργίες εκτελούνται χρησιμοποιώντας τις ακόλουθες εντολές:

  1. adduser : προσθήκη χρήστη στο σύστημα.
  2. userdel : διαγραφή λογαριασμού χρήστη και σχετικών αρχείων.
  3. addgroup : προσθήκη ομάδας στο σύστημα.
  4. delgroup : αφαιρέστε μια ομάδα από το σύστημα.
  5. usermod : τροποποίηση λογαριασμού χρήστη.
  6. chage : αλλαγή των στοιχείων λήξης κωδικού πρόσβασης χρήστη.

30 Ιουλίου. 2018 г.

Πώς μπορώ να περιορίσω έναν χρήστη στον αρχικό μου κατάλογο στο Linux;

Περιορίστε τους χρήστες Linux μόνο στους οικιακούς καταλόγους τους

  1. Αλλαγή καταλόγων με cd.
  2. Ρύθμιση ή κατάργηση των τιμών των SHELL, PATH, ENV ή BASH_ENV.
  3. Καθορισμός ονομάτων εντολών που περιέχουν /
  4. Καθορισμός ονόματος αρχείου που περιέχει ένα / ως όρισμα στο . …
  5. Καθορισμός ονόματος αρχείου που περιέχει κάθετο ως όρισμα στην επιλογή -p στην εντολή ενσωματωμένη κατακερματισμός.

27 αυγ. 2006 г.

Πώς μπορώ να περιορίσω έναν χρήστη σε έναν συγκεκριμένο κατάλογο;

Δημιουργήστε μια νέα ομάδα για να προσθέσετε όλους τους χρήστες σε αυτήν την ομάδα.

  1. περιορισμός προσθήκης sudo group.
  2. sudo useradd -g περιορισμός όνομα χρήστη.
  3. sudo usermod -g περιορισμός όνομα χρήστη.
  4. Αντιστοίχιση ονόματος χρήστη ChrootDirectory /path/to/folder ForceCommand interior-sftp AllowTcpForwarding no X11Forwarding no.
  5. όνομα χρήστη sftp@IP_ADDRESS.

Τι είναι το περιορισμένο κέλυφος στο Linux;

6.10 Το περιορισμένο κέλυφος

Ένα περιορισμένο κέλυφος χρησιμοποιείται για τη δημιουργία ενός περιβάλλοντος πιο ελεγχόμενου από το τυπικό κέλυφος. Ένα περιορισμένο κέλυφος συμπεριφέρεται πανομοιότυπα με το bash με την εξαίρεση ότι τα ακόλουθα δεν επιτρέπονται ή δεν εκτελούνται: Αλλαγή καταλόγων με το ενσωματωμένο cd.

Τι είναι το Rbash στο Linux;

Τι είναι το rbash; Το Restricted Shell είναι ένα Linux Shell που περιορίζει ορισμένες από τις δυνατότητες του bash shell και είναι πολύ σαφές από το όνομα. Ο περιορισμός εφαρμόζεται καλά για την εντολή καθώς και για το σενάριο που εκτελείται σε περιορισμένο κέλυφος. Παρέχει ένα πρόσθετο επίπεδο ασφάλειας για το bash shell στο Linux.

Πώς μπορώ να κάνω λίστα χρηστών στο Linux;

Για να καταχωρίσετε τους χρήστες στο Linux, πρέπει να εκτελέσετε την εντολή "cat" στο αρχείο "/etc/passwd". Κατά την εκτέλεση αυτής της εντολής, θα εμφανιστεί η λίστα των χρηστών που είναι διαθέσιμοι αυτήν τη στιγμή στο σύστημά σας. Εναλλακτικά, μπορείτε να χρησιμοποιήσετε την εντολή «λιγότερο» ή «περισσότερο» για να πλοηγηθείτε στη λίστα ονομάτων χρήστη.

Ποιοι είναι οι τύποι χρηστών στο Linux;

Υπάρχουν τρεις τύποι χρηστών στο linux: – root, κανονικός και service.

Πώς βλέπω τους χρήστες στο Linux;

Πώς να κάνετε λίστα χρηστών στο Linux

  1. Λάβετε μια λίστα με όλους τους χρήστες χρησιμοποιώντας το αρχείο /etc/passwd.
  2. Λάβετε μια λίστα με όλους τους χρήστες που χρησιμοποιούν την εντολή getent.
  3. Ελέγξτε εάν υπάρχει χρήστης στο σύστημα Linux.
  4. Σύστημα και Κανονικοί Χρήστες.

12 Απρ. 2020 г.

Πώς μπορώ να επιτρέψω μόνο σε συγκεκριμένους χρήστες να SSH διακομιστή Linux μου;

Περιορίστε τη σύνδεση ορισμένων χρηστών σε ένα σύστημα μέσω διακομιστή SSH

  1. Βήμα # 1: Ανοίξτε το αρχείο sshd_config. # vi /etc/ssh/sshd_config.
  2. Βήμα # 2: Προσθήκη χρήστη. Επιτρέψτε στο χρήστη vivek να συνδεθεί μόνο προσθέτοντας την ακόλουθη γραμμή: AllowUsers vivek.
  3. Βήμα # 3: Επανεκκινήστε το sshd. Αποθηκεύστε και κλείστε το αρχείο. Στο παραπάνω παράδειγμα, ο χρήστης vivek έχει ήδη δημιουργηθεί στο σύστημα. Τώρα απλά επανεκκινήστε το sshd:

25 .нв. 2007 г.

Πώς μπορώ να περιορίσω το SCP στο Linux;

Όπως έχουν σημειώσει άλλοι, δεν μπορείτε να αποκλείσετε το scp (καλά, θα μπορούσατε: rm /usr/bin/scp , αλλά αυτό δεν σας οδηγεί πουθενά). Το καλύτερο που μπορείτε να κάνετε είναι να αλλάξετε το κέλυφος των χρηστών σε περιορισμένο κέλυφος (rbash) και μόνο τότε να εκτελέσετε ορισμένες εντολές. Θυμηθείτε, εάν μπορούν να διαβάσουν αρχεία, μπορούν να τα αντιγράψουν/επικολλήσουν από την οθόνη.

Πώς μπορώ να περιορίσω το SFTP σε έναν κατάλογο στο Linux;

Περιορίστε την πρόσβαση χρήστη SFTP σε συγκεκριμένους καταλόγους στο Linux

  1. Εγκαταστήστε το διακομιστή OpenSSH. Για να μπορείτε να διαμορφώσετε την περιορισμένη πρόσβαση καταλόγου για χρήστες SFTP, βεβαιωθείτε ότι είναι εγκατεστημένος ο διακομιστής OpenSSH. …
  2. Δημιουργία μη προνομιούχου λογαριασμού χρήστη SFTP. …
  3. Περιορίστε την πρόσβαση χρήστη SFTP στον Κατάλογο με το Chroot Jail. …
  4. Επαλήθευση πρόσβασης καταλόγου περιορισμένης πρόσβασης χρήστη SFTP. …
  5. Σχετικά σεμινάρια.

16 μαρ. 2020 г.

Πώς μπορώ να περιορίσω τους χρήστες σε έναν φάκελο στο SFTP;

Περιορισμένη πρόσβαση μόνο σε SFTP σε έναν μεμονωμένο κατάλογο χρησιμοποιώντας το OpenSSH

  1. Δημιουργήστε μια ομάδα συστήματος ανταλλαγής αρχείων .
  2. Δημιουργήστε έναν κατάλογο /home/exchangefiles/ και κατάλογο αρχείων/ μέσα σε αυτόν.
  3. Να επιτρέπεται στους χρήστες της ομάδας ανταλλαγής αρχείων να συνδέονται στον διακομιστή χρησιμοποιώντας SFTP (αλλά όχι SSH).
  4. Κλειδώστε τους χρήστες στην ομάδα exchangefiles στον κατάλογο /home/exchangefiles/ χρησιμοποιώντας ένα chroot.

15 .нв. 2014 г.

Πώς μπορώ να κάνω chroot έναν χρήστη;

Σημειώστε ότι θα εκτελέσουμε όλες τις εντολές ως root, χρησιμοποιήστε την εντολή sudo εάν είστε συνδεδεμένοι στον διακομιστή ως κανονικός χρήστης.

  1. Βήμα 1: Δημιουργήστε SSH Chroot Jail. …
  2. Βήμα 2: Ρύθμιση Interactive Shell για SSH Chroot Jail. …
  3. Βήμα 3: Δημιουργία και διαμόρφωση χρήστη SSH. …
  4. Βήμα 4: Διαμορφώστε το SSH για χρήση του Chroot Jail. …
  5. Βήμα 5: Δοκιμή SSH με το Chroot Jail.

10 μαρ. 2017 г.

Πώς μπορώ να περιορίσω το SSH;

Πώς να περιορίσετε την πρόσβαση SSH μόνο σε συγκεκριμένες IP

  1. Τώρα θα επιτρέψουμε μια λίστα γνωστών IP που θα πρέπει να μπορούν να συνδεθούν στο SSH. Για αυτό πρέπει να προσθέσουμε μια καταχώρηση στο /etc/hosts. …
  2. Ανοίξτε το αρχείο /etc/hosts.allow χρησιμοποιώντας τον αγαπημένο σας επεξεργαστή κειμένου vi /etc/hosts.deny. και προσθέστε τις ακόλουθες γραμμές για να αρνηθείτε όλες τις συνδέσεις SSH στη δημόσια θύρα SSH sshd: ALL.
Σας αρέσει αυτή η ανάρτηση; Παρακαλώ μοιραστείτε με τους φίλους σας:
OS σήμερα